French property transactions follow clear legal frameworks, with notaire-led conveyancing ensuring buyer protection and title registration. Most transactions are in euros and involve a two-stage process: the preliminary contract and deed of sale. International buyers are active, often collaborating with professional advisors fluent in both languages and cross-border fiscal considerations. The village enjoys a classic Alpine climate, with crisp, snow-rich winters supporting extended ski seasons from December to April. Summers offer mild temperatures and abundant sunshine, ideal for outdoor pursuits and relaxation.
Brief shoulder transitions in spring and autumn encourage peaceful escapes, sustaining year-round appeal for those seeking a harmonious blend of invigorating cold and balmy warmth.
